Abstract:BackgroundIn Lupoid Leishmaniasis, erythematous to brown papules often occur around a central old scar, which can expand over time. For unclear reasons, these lesions tend to develop on the facial area.ObjectivesThis study was conducted to study the distribution of Lupoid Leishmaniasis lesions on the face and compare them with those of acute leishmaniasis.MethodsThis case‐control study included 100 patients with the acute type of cutaneous leishmaniasis and Lupoid Leishmaniasis who were referred to the dermato… Show more
